When mold grows indoors, exposure to it can cause various health problems and property damage. That’s why mold prevention should be a priority for any homeowner. But to understand mold prevention, we must first understand why it grows in the first place.

How does mold grow in homes?

Mold begins to grow when the conditions are right. It needs just three things to grow:

Food - Anything that used to be alive (wood, cardboard, paper, wool, silk, leather, etc.).
Temperature - Mold thrives in the range of 68°F to 86°F (the same range we typically keep our homes).
Water - Very little is needed. In fact, the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) says that indoor humidity above 60% is enough to allow mold to develop.

What are the best ways to prevent black mold growth?

Control ...
... moisture

1. Regularly check for pipe leaks, burst pipes, or any other potential source of errant water that could cause moisture inside your house. This includes regular inspection of gutters and drainpipes that help keep water out during rain.

2. Keep moisture out through proper ventilation. Invest in exhaust fans or open your windows to improve airflow, especially in areas prone to getting wet like your laundry room, bathroom, and kitchen.

3. It only takes 24 to 48 hours for mold to start growing, so if things do get wet, dry them immediately. This is true even for clothes and towels. Hang them outside or in a room with proper ventilation instead of just leaving them lying around.

4. Keep the humidity inside your house below 60%. Use dehumidifiers or air conditioners and familiarize yourself with the local weather if needed.

Minimize mold spores

1. Mold spores can stick to your clothes and shoes until you get home. Pets can bring them inside with their fur. They can even float in through open windows, given the right wind condition. The bottom line is, mold spores can get inside your house whether you like it or not. Dust and vacuum regularly to remove mold spores that have settled inside your house.

2. Use air purifiers to remove airborne mold spores. The ones with HEPA filter are most effective, able to remove 99% of air pollutants.
